FB_DALIV2Compare

FB_DALIV2Compare 1:

The ballast compares its RANDOM ADDRESS with the SEARCH ADDRESS. If the random address is smaller than or equal to the search address, and if the ballast is not connected, then the output bAnswer is set to TRUE.

VAR_INPUT

bStart            : BOOL;
eCommandPriority   : E_DALIV2CommandPriority := eDALIV2CommandPriorityMiddle;

bStart: The block is activated by a rising edge at this input.

eCommandPriority: The priority (high, middle, low) this command has when executed by the library.

VAR_OUTPUT

bBusy          : BOOL;
bError         : BOOL;
nErrorId       : UDINT;
bAnswer        : BOOL;

bBusy: When the block is activated the output is set, and it remains active until execution of the command has been completed.

bError: This output is switched to TRUE if an error occurs during the execution of a command. The command-specific error code is contained in nErrorId. Is reset to FALSE by the execution of an instruction at the inputs.

nErrorId: Contains the command-specific error code of the most recently executed command. Is reset to 0 by the execution of an instruction at the inputs. See Error codes.

bAnswer: The random address is smaller than or equal to the search address.

VAR_IN_OUT

stCommandBuffer    : ST_DALIV2CommandBuffer;

stCommandBuffer: A reference to the structure for communication with the FB_DALIV2Communication() (KL6811) or FB_KL6821Communication() (KL6821) block.
